DSCN2984I heard about the delicious Xiao lun bao-like soup dumplings at this small family owned restaurant that specialized in dumplings. The dumplings are handmade and sold out fast. So we made an effort to wake up early on the weekend (rare case for us ^^;;) and arrived at around noon, and still the soup dumplings were sold out already. There are still many items to order from the small menu that’s half devoted to different kinds of dumplings and the other half to noodles. Small size beef noodle and the very good free chopped celery, tofu-gan (five-spice dry tofu) and peanuts side dish.

DSCN2986
We tried two dumplings: Pork and Celery and pork and shrimp. Juicy and delicious! The skin is the thick Northern kind. They also have fried dumplings which every table seems to have an order of. I’ll definitely try it next time and hopefully the soup dumplings won’t be sold out.
